AI summary NSPI, Nova Scotia's primary electricity supplier with $8.1B in assets, operates 2,422 MW of generating capacity (44% coal/oil, 28% gas/oil, 19% renewables). It sources 40% of sales from renewables and has agreements with NLH for 900 GWh annually. NSPI also owns grid-scale batteries and contracts with IPPs/COMFIT participants for 573 MW of renewable capacity.
